What is a Remote Seafood Processor job?

A Remote Seafood Processor is responsible for preparing and packaging seafood in a remote location, often at sea or in a processing facility in a secluded area. Duties may include cleaning, cutting, sorting, freezing, and packaging seafood products while maintaining sanitation and safety standards. The job often requires long hours, physical labor, and working in cold or wet conditions. Many positions are seasonal, and employees may live on-site for extended periods.
